WHO WE ARE

Formally launched in October 2021, EnterpriseNGR is an independent professional policy and advocacy group established with the objective of promoting and advocating for the Financial and Professional Services (FPS) sector of Nigeria.

Founded by some of the sector's key players, we aim to transform Nigeria into the premier financial services center in Africa, improve financial literacy and inclusion, while significantly impacting the quality of life of Nigerians.

Leveraging the expertise of our members - experienced industry professionals across various sub-sectors of the Nigerian FPS sector, we are positioned to harness the country’s inherent economic potential, developing a strong and resilient economy.

Our flagship initiative, the ‘Youths of Enterprise’, is an internship programme that aims to recruit and upskill 5,000 interns annually, matching them with our partner organisations for a high-value six-month internship. This is the first of many endeavors in our commitment to building a better Nigeria.

WHAT WE DO

We promote the importance of the FPS sector to national economic development and strengthen awareness of its cross-cutting impact on the economy as a whole. We also promote the interest of our members locally and globally.

We advocate for the sector as one voice, proactively engaging with policy makers and regulators to influence the direction of policy initiatives based on strong evidence-based research and global best practice. We also support regulators in the process of formulating and implementing optimal policies for the sector.

We connect our members to high level policy makers and regulators and facilitate their working together to define issues and proffer solutions that foster a favourable FPS operating environment.

We build local and global networks to promote trade and investment and encourage innovation across all subsectors of the FPS sector.

We support the development of strong sector operators and help them to regionalize their businesses across Africa taking full advantage of the Africa Continental Free Trade Agreement.

We intervene directly in the economy to be the solution that we advocate for in key priority areas. Our first intervention is the Youth of Enterprise (YOE) internship program, an initiative to generate high impact jobs for Nigerian youths.

KEY PRIORITIES

FINANCIAL INCLUSION

Availability and equality of opportunities to access financial services. It refers to a process by which individuals and businesses can access appropriate, affordable, and timely financial products and services. These include banking, loan, equity insurance products etc.

DIGITISATION

Improving adoption of technology across various sub-sectors of Financial and Professional Services.

REGIONALISATION

Encourage the expansion of Nigerian FPS operators across the continent while also positioning Nigeria to take full advantage of the African Continental Free Trade Area.

INTERNATIONAL TRADE AND DEVELOPMENT

Actively promote Nigeria as a prime destination for international trade and investment while facilitating seamless investments and trade.

SUSTAINABILITY

Encouraging the sector to take into consideration environmental, social and governance (ESG) principles in their operations and investment philosophies.
